Democracy Quote by Fareed Zakaria
““The political history of the twentieth century is the story of greater and more direct political participation. And success kept expanding democracy's scope. Whatever the ailment, more democracy became the cure.””
About This Quote
The quote argues that the 20th century saw expanding political participation, with democracy acting as a remedy to societal problems.
